Output 529631e2cb7234c2f28dcb0f96f1264bd7a8af1272479ee1351855ef71fe0697:1

value
136985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d97e4d58a3fcbc6bd51cee171757565379b71f5 OP_EQUALVERIFY OP_CHECKSIG
address
12EskGRFvPNdWDA46nLqEgNNcd3LeJmu6Q
transaction
529631e2cb7234c2f28dcb0f96f1264bd7a8af1272479ee1351855ef71fe0697
confirmations
50122
spent
true